As the name indicates, wood-fired hot tubs by Hot Tubs in France heat water by using wood – not expensive electricity. There are no pumps running 24/7 on these tubs, no expensive heaters to run. With good filtration systems the water can last up to two months and even without, it easily lasts a month with non-chlorinated, minimal chemical water cleaners meaning you can use the water in the garden.
Hot tubs for cold days
On cold days, you’ll enjoy a beautiful crackling fire, relaxing warm water, and a cosy sanctuary. And it’s not just about enhancing your lifestyle, science shows that soaking in a hot tub is good for wellness and mental health, relieving muscle and joint aches, helping to reduce stress and improving sleep. Warm water immersion helps your body release dopamine, the naturally produced “feel good” drug. According to Dr. Bobby Buka, a New York dermatologist, your skin actually releases endorphins when you’re submerged in warm water, similar to the way it releases endorphins when you feel the sun on your skin. Soaking for 20-30 minutes is a great way to feel those stress-relieving benefits.
Soaking in a tub of hot water started in ancient Japan as a ritual called ablution, which means purification. This ritual became a ceremonial part of Japanese culture to represent spiritual and physical renewal, cleansing the body and purifying the soul.
